You can create a panorama picture by using PictureGear 2. 5SE or higher. Sending still images via e-mail To send still images via e-mail, proceed as follows: 1 2 3 4 5 6 Click the Start button on the Windows® taskbar. Your e-mail window appears with the selected file attached to your message. Send the e-mail. You need to set up MAPI (Messaging Application Program Interface) when using the e-mail software. MAPI is a Microsoft® Windows® program interface that enables you to send e-mails from within a Windows® application and to attach the document you are working on to the e-mail note. This only removes the clip from the tray, the The Import dialog box appears. After adding clip(s) to the Clip tray, you can create a short movie using the Shaker feature. Shaker randomly selects clips from the Clip tray to create a 30-second scene. Select a mood by clicking a face in the Shaker tray To preview the created movie, proceed as follows: 1 2 Double-click the scene in the Product tray Press Play . A thirty-second scene is automatically generated and saved to the Product tray. Scenes created with Shaker begin with a black frame. After processing, they are placed in the first available slot on the Product tray. MovieShaker may stop responding if there are too many scenes in the Product tray.
